Plus One
"Plus One", is a charming and heartwarming romantic comedy short film written by Andrea Louise Watson. It doesn't have to be perfect to make it the perfect day. Lily and James are on their first date, and things couldn't be going more wrong - their car has broken down on the way to a wedding. But as they wait for a mechanic to arrive, they begin to bond over the day's mishaps and realize that sometimes, the imperfect moments can be the most memorable. Starring Andrea Louise Watson and Alexander King, "Plus One" is a gentle and lighthearted comedy that will leave you smiling from ear to ear. Sometimes, the bumps in the road can lead to the most beautiful destinations. Written by Andrea Louise Watson Starring Andrea Louise Watson, and Alexander King Directed by Velton Lishke D.O.P Josh Blewitt

Forever Home Written by Andrea Louise Watson
"Forever Home" is a heartwarming short film that takes place during the Christmas Jodie, played by Alice Loftus, is a foster child who overhears a conversation between her foster mum and social worker, and worries about where she will live after Christmas. This touching story portrays the importance of family, love, and finding a place to call home. starring Alison Lofus and Andrea Louise Watson. Written by Andrea Louise Watson Director: Velton Lishke. DOP : Josh Blewitt. Sound: Lee Watson.

Staying Strong
A Monologue written and performed by Andrea Louise Watson. A grieving mother turns to a therapist to help her stay strong for her family not realising her strength is love and she needs to grieve. Music - Copyright free A Quiet Thought Wayne Jones

Take a hike for Aunt Alice
Eccentric hippy Kitty meets scatter-brained housewife Amelia and fastidious Duncan in an isolated car park as they prepare to take their Aunt Alice on her final journey.

REGRETS
When Sally's sister Katherine visits unexpectedly, Sally has to break some bad news. Only the arrival of Revd Peters could make an awkward evening even more uncomfortable.
